I had been researching the end of Benno Moiseiwitsch`s career to see if I had heard his final concert in London. That led to the story of Daisy Kennedy . They were married but later divorced . Daisy Kennedy was a violinist from Australia and if you search around there is a short recording of her playing . She was a superbly gifted musician and her cousin was in the same gene pool that led to Nigel Kennedy the all round great violinist .
I almost forgot to say that Moiseiwitsch was born in Ukraine (Not Russia ) and studied piano in Odessa .That was in the old days when Odessa was spelled with a double S.Then he moved to Vienna and later on England and a worldwide career . |
